Device description
A robotic, powered exoskeleton with motors at the hips, knees and ankles, as well as additional actuators offering someone with lower-limb paralysis fast, stable, and agile upright mobility.
- Utilizing modular actuation, perception technology from autonomous vehicles, and control algorithms for balancing autonomous humanoid robots, this device will deliver the mobility, safety, and independence that current exoskeletons cannot.
- The lightweight exoskeleton device will improve mobility for people with paralysis, opening up new employment opportunities.
- It support the natural movements of the body with a series of actuators around the ankles and the knees for greater mobility.
